How Does the Military and Defence Industry Use Waterjet Cutting Technology?

The military and defence sectors require cutting-edge technology for the production of complex components, machinery parts, armoured systems, and structural elements. Waterjet cutting for military and defence is widely used due to its non-thermal, high-precision process.

  1. Armour Plate Fabrication: Waterjet cutting is essential in shaping high-grade ballistic armour plates. It maintains the hardness of the material since there’s no heat-affected zone. It ensures durability and resistance in battlefield conditions. The precise cuts also allow for lightweight custom designs. Waterjet cutting for military and defence helps in achieving both protection and mobility.
  2. Missile and Rocket Components: Precision is paramount in aerospace weaponry. Waterjet cutting service is used to create exact geometries for missile nozzles, warhead enclosures, and engine parts. The cold-cutting process ensures zero thermal stress on sensitive materials. This enhances flight stability and targeting accuracy. It is ideal for producing both prototypes and operational parts.
  3. Fighter Aircraft Part Manufacturing: In aviation, every gram matters. Waterjet cutting is used for titanium, aluminium, and carbon fibre parts in fighter jets. It includes brackets, wing ribs, and cockpit framework. Its burr-free cutting reduces the need for secondary machining.   4. Body Armour and Personal Gear: Soldier protection systems utilise Kevlar, ceramic, and composite materials. These are hard to cut using traditional methods. Waterjet cutting handles layered and complex materials without causing fraying or breakage. The process ensures consistency in shapes, improving comfort and protection. It’s crucial in manufacturing modern infantry gear.
  5. Tank and Armoured Vehicle Panels: Thick steel and composite panels in tanks require clean, precise cuts. Waterjet systems can handle materials up to several inches thick. The non-contact process eliminates vibration damage. It is vital for structural integrity during heavy combat. Waterjet cutting for military and defence ensures reliable vehicle performance.
  6. Naval Ship and Submarine Structures: In shipbuilding, waterjets cut steel and corrosion-resistant alloys used in naval hulls. These structures require intricate fittings and joinery for watertight integrity. Waterjet cutting enables detailed shaping with tight tolerances. The absence of slag or burn marks ensures a perfect surface for welding. It’s widely adopted in naval shipyards globally.

What are the Materials That Can Be Cut With a Waterjet?

The versatility of waterjet cutting for military and defence lies in its ability to slice through a wide array of materials with unmatched accuracy:

  1. Steel (Mild, Hardened, Stainless): Steel is a foundational material in defence production. Waterjet cutting handles it across all grades and thicknesses. The cut edges remain smooth and heat-free. It maintains the material’s structural integrity.   2. Titanium: Used in aircraft and missile parts, titanium is lightweight but strong. Traditional methods can deform it due to heat. Waterjet cutting produces clean edges without weakening the alloy. This is crucial for safety in aviation and space missions. It is widely used in waterjet cutting for military and defence.
  3. Aluminium Alloys: Aluminium is popular for vehicles, drones, and portable systems. Waterjet systems cut through it without producing harmful dust or sparks. The precision of the process is suitable for thin panels and thick blocks alike. Minimal edge damage reduces post-processing. It’s perfect for both structural and decorative components.
  4. Plastics and Acrylics: Used for casing, control panels, and insulation. Waterjet cutting produces clean cuts without melting or burning. It is ideal for maintaining tolerances in electronic components. Multiple sheets can be stacked and cut together. Our waterjet cutting service handles various plastic grades.
  5. Rubber and Foam Seals: Critical for sealing hatches, enclosures, and equipment. Waterjet machines cut rubber gaskets with excellent edge definition. Even soft or spongy materials retain shape post-cutting. The absence of distortion is key for long-lasting performance. Defence systems benefit from accurate sealing solutions.
  6. Copper and Brass: Often used in electronics and communication systems. Waterjets cut these metals without sparking, unlike traditional blades. It allows for safe shaping in sensitive environments. Electrical contacts, coils, and bus bars can be manufactured accurately. It’s a safe and efficient method for handling conductive materials.

What are the Benefits of Waterjet Systems in the Defence Industry?

  1. Cold Cutting Process: The waterjet method involves no heat, avoiding warping or hardening. Materials retain their original physical properties. This is vital in critical defence components. It also prevents toxic fume emissions. Waterjet cutting for military and defence prioritises safety and integrity.
  2. High Precision for Tight Tolerances: Waterjets cut with tolerances as fine as ±0.1 mm. This precision is essential in aerospace and guided weapon systems. Consistency ensures system reliability. It reduces the need for rework and post-finishing. Quality and accuracy are greatly improved.
  3. Versatility of Material Use: As discussed, a wide range of materials can be processed. This versatility streamlines the production pipeline from composite armour to fine electronic enclosures.   4. Environmentally Friendly Operation: No harmful gases or dust are produced during cutting. There’s minimal waste and no tool wear. This improves workplace health and sustainability. It’s especially useful in enclosed or secure military facilities. Water recycling systems further reduce environmental impact.
  5. Minimal Setup Time: Unlike dies or moulds, waterjet cutting doesn’t require tooling. CAD designs are fed directly to the machine. This reduces production lead times drastically. It supports on-demand production in urgent situations. An ideal choice for defence logistics.
  6. Smooth Edges and Surface Quality: Parts emerge with clean edges that need little or no finishing. This enhances part fitment and reduces assembly time. Smooth finishes are important in mobile and aerospace units. Vibration and stress points are reduced. It helps in extending service life.
  7. Cost-Effectiveness in Batch Production: While ideal for prototypes, waterjet cutting also supports bulk runs. It improves material utilisation with nested layouts. Reduced waste and high speed, lower cost per unit. Defence projects benefit from both flexibility and savings.   8. Safe and Non-Toxic Cutting Method: The process uses water mixed with abrasive garnet. There are no flames, lasers, or toxic coolants involved. This makes it safer for operators and secure locations. Noise levels are also lower than those of mechanical processes. It aligns with military safety protocols.
